QA Automation Engineer (Networking)

PLVision is looking for a QA (Quality Assurance) Automation Engineer with excellent knowledge of Python and Bash, as well as hands-on experience with Layer 2/Layer 3 protocols testing. You will get a stable job on a growing project for our client, a US-Israel innovative semiconductor startup that creates products for cloud service providers and data center networks. As a QA (Quality Assurance) Automation Engineer, you will become an integral part of our team, responsible for verification of SAI-like API and enabling SONiC (Software for Open Networking in the Cloud) OS support on the top of SAI (Switch Abstraction Interface) for a new router product.

 

Join PLVision, a reliable Ukrainian company, and collaborate with experienced engineers in a future-proof networking domain. Apply now and secure your career!

 

About PLVision

We are a software product development company specializing in computer networking and embedded systems. PLVision has offices in Krakow, Poland, and in Ukraine: Lviv, Odesa, Kyiv, and Kharkiv (currently relocated). Founded in 2007, the company helps networking industry leaders and ambitious startups in the U.S., Israel, and the EU countries to launch innovative products.

 

Vacancy responsibilities:

- Develop test plans and test cases

- Execute automation testing

- Report, investigate and debug issues

- Develop and extend the test framework

- Investigate and report test results

 

Vacancy requirements:

- Bachelor's degree in Computer Science or Software/Computer/Communication Engineering

- At least 3 years of experience with Python

- Test automation experience (Python/Bash)

- Good knowledge of network protocols Layer 2/Layer 3 of the Open Systems Interconnection (OSI) model

- Hands-on experience with Network Protocol Testing (L2/L3)

- Understanding of Continuous Improvement methodologies and tools (Gerrit, Jenkins, etc.)

- Familiarity with Linux as a working environment

- Strong analytical, debugging and problem-solving skills

- Understanding of Ethernet traffic analyzers: Wireshark, TCPDUMP, etc.

- Knowledge of technical English at Intermediate level and higher

 

Vacancy plus options:

- Experience in Test Plan development

- Familiarity with Ansible

- Experience with SAI(Switch Abstraction Interface)/ SONiC(Software for Open Networking in the Cloud)

- Acquaintance with hardware or software traffic generators: Ixia, Spirent, T-Rex, Ostinato, Scapy, etc.

- Experience with Ethernet Switches: Cisco/Arista/Juniper Switches/Routers or similar


To apply for this and other jobs on Djinni login or signup.